Long Term Rental (BRRRR)

A long-term investment strategy that includes Buying an asset, Repairing, Renting, Refinancing it, and Repeating the procedure by spending the cash from the mortgage refinance is called BRRRR. This is a strategy to increase your investment assets rather than own a single rental property. This strategy depends on your capability to withdraw money out when you refinance.

You improve the worth of the asset above the amount you spent acquiring and rehabbing the asset. The investment property is refinanced based on the ARV and the balance, or equity, is given to you in cash. You purchase your next rental with the cash-out money and begin anew. You add improving investment assets to your balance sheet and lease income to your cash flow.

Short-Term Rental Cash-on-Cash Return

To understand whether you should put your cash in a particular rental unit or market, compute the cash-on-cash return. You can determine the cash-on-cash return by taking your Net Operating Income (NOI) and dividing it by your cash investment. The percentage you get is your cash-on-cash return. High cash-on-cash return means that you will recoup your capital more quickly and the purchase will earn more profit. Financed investment ventures will reap stronger cash-on-cash returns as you’re utilizing less of your own money.

Average Short-Term Rental Capitalization (Cap) Rates

This benchmark shows the comparability of investment property value to its yearly return. Generally, the less money a unit will cost (or is worth), the higher the cap rate will be. When cap rates are low, you can prepare to spend more cash for real estate in that city. You can determine the cap rate for possible investment property by dividing the Net Operating Income (NOI) by the Fair Market Value or asking price of the property. The percentage you get is the investment property’s cap rate.

Wholesaling

Wholesaling is a real estate investment approach that involves scouting out houses that are attractive to real estate investors and putting them under a sale and purchase agreement. When a real estate investor who needs the residential property is spotted, the purchase contract is assigned to the buyer for a fee. The property is bought by the investor, not the wholesaler. The real estate wholesaler doesn’t sell the property under contract itself — they simply sell the purchase and sale agreement.

Mortgage Note Investing

Note investors purchase debt from lenders when they can get the note for a lower price than the balance owed. The client makes remaining payments to the note investor who has become their new lender.

Loans that are being repaid as agreed are referred to as performing loans. Performing loans are a consistent provider of cash flow. Non-performing notes can be re-negotiated or you can acquire the property at a discount via a foreclosure process.

Foreclosure Laws

Investors should understand their state’s regulations regarding foreclosure prior to pursuing this strategy. Are you faced with a Deed of Trust or a mortgage? A mortgage dictates that the lender goes to court for authority to foreclose. You do not need the court’s approval with a Deed of Trust.

Property Taxes

Many borrowers pay real estate taxes to mortgage lenders in monthly installments along with their mortgage loan payments. That way, the lender makes sure that the taxes are paid when due. The mortgage lender will need to make up the difference if the payments stop or the investor risks tax liens on the property. If taxes are delinquent, the government’s lien supersedes any other liens to the front of the line and is satisfied first.

If a region has a history of growing property tax rates, the total house payments in that region are regularly growing. Overdue clients may not have the ability to keep up with growing loan payments and might stop making payments altogether.

Syndications

In real estate investing, a syndication is a group of investors who pool their money and talents to buy real estate properties for investment. The syndication is organized by a person who enlists other investors to join the project.

The person who puts everything together is the Sponsor, also known as the Syndicator. The Syndicator manages all real estate details including buying or building properties and overseeing their use. The Sponsor manages all business details including the disbursement of revenue.

The remaining shareholders are passive investors. They are assigned a preferred amount of the profits following the acquisition or construction completion. But only the manager(s) of the syndicate can handle the business of the company.

Ownership Interest

Each member owns a percentage of the company. If the company includes sweat equity members, expect those who inject cash to be compensated with a more significant amount of ownership.

As a cash investor, you should also intend to be given a preferred return on your capital before profits are distributed. Preferred return is a portion of the money invested that is distributed to capital investors from net revenues. After it’s paid, the rest of the net revenues are distributed to all the participants.

If partnership assets are sold at a profit, the profits are distributed among the shareholders. The combined return on a venture like this can really jump when asset sale net proceeds are combined with the yearly revenues from a profitable venture. The partnership’s operating agreement explains the ownership structure and the way everyone is dealt with financially.

REITs

Some real estate investment firms are conceived as trusts called Real Estate Investment Trusts or REITs. REITs were developed to permit average investors to invest in properties. The typical person can afford to invest in a REIT.

Investing in a REIT is one of the types of passive investing. Investment liability is spread throughout a group of properties. Shareholders have the option to unload their shares at any time. However, REIT investors don’t have the capability to pick particular properties or locations. The assets that the REIT decides to purchase are the ones your capital is used to purchase.

Real Estate Investment Funds

Mutual funds that hold shares of real estate companies are termed real estate investment funds. The investment properties are not owned by the fund — they’re held by the companies in which the fund invests. These funds make it possible for more investors to invest in real estate properties. Fund members might not collect usual distributions the way that REIT participants do. Like other stocks, investment funds’ values rise and fall with their share market value.

You may select a fund that concentrates on a targeted kind of real estate you’re knowledgeable about, but you don’t get to select the location of each real estate investment. You must rely on the fund’s managers to determine which locations and real estate properties are picked for investment.
